4. Set up Simplicity
Set up simplicity is a key consideration when using a PVC pipe take a look at cap with out knockout. The benefit and pace with which the cap might be securely connected to a PVC pipe immediately impacts labor prices, challenge timelines, and the general effectivity of plumbing system testing.
-
Solvent Welding Course of
The first set up technique for a PVC pipe take a look at cap with out knockout is solvent welding. This includes making use of a primer to scrub and soften each the internal floor of the cap and the outer floor of the pipe. Subsequently, PVC cement is utilized to create a chemical bond between the 2 surfaces. This course of, whereas comparatively simple, requires adherence to particular procedures to make sure a dependable, leak-proof seal. For example, insufficient utility of primer or cement, or inadequate curing time, can compromise the integrity of the joint, resulting in failures throughout stress testing. The absence of a knockout characteristic necessitates cautious execution, as elimination requires slicing the pipe or cap, including to the complexity if the preliminary set up is flawed.
-
Alignment and Insertion
Correct alignment and insertion depth are essential for a profitable solvent weld. The cap have to be aligned squarely with the pipe to make sure uniform contact between the bonding surfaces. Inadequate insertion depth reduces the floor space obtainable for bonding, whereas extreme insertion can create stress factors throughout the joint. In sensible eventualities, improper alignment can result in uneven cement distribution and localized weaknesses within the seal. This highlights the necessity for exact measurements and cautious consideration to element through the set up course of. Appropriate alignment ensures that the stress is distributed evenly throughout the joint, maximizing its resistance to leaks.

-
Environmental Circumstances
Environmental situations can influence the set up simplicity and success of solvent welding. Excessive temperatures or humidity can have an effect on the curing time and bonding energy of the PVC cement. For instance, in chilly climate, the cement might take longer to remedy, rising the danger of motion or disturbance earlier than the joint is totally set. Conversely, in sizzling climate, the cement might dry too shortly, stopping correct bonding. Consequently, it is crucial to regulate the set up procedures primarily based on the prevailing environmental situations, corresponding to offering satisfactory shelter from direct daylight or utilizing a warmth supply to heat the joint in chilly temperatures. This ensures optimum bonding and a safe, leak-proof seal.

Materials Degradation Mechanisms
Incompatible chemical compounds could cause varied types of degradation in PVC, together with swelling, softening, cracking, or dissolution. These degradation mechanisms compromise the cap’s structural integrity and sealing capabilities. For instance, publicity to sure fragrant hydrocarbons could cause PVC to swell and lose its dimensional stability, resulting in a compromised seal. Equally, extended publicity to sturdy oxidizing brokers could cause floor cracking, decreasing the cap’s capability to resist stress. Understanding these degradation mechanisms is crucial for choosing a cap materials with satisfactory resistance to the precise chemical setting.

Ideas for Efficient Use of PVC Pipe Check Caps With out Knockout
The following pointers present steerage for optimum utility and upkeep of PVC pipe take a look at caps, enhancing system reliability and minimizing potential problems.
Tip 1: Choose the Appropriate Dimension: Confirm that the take a look at cap exactly matches the outer diameter of the PVC pipe. An improperly sized cap compromises the seal and invalidates take a look at outcomes. Seek the advice of pipe dimension charts and measure fastidiously.
Tip 2: Guarantee Correct Floor Preparation: Completely clear each the inside of the cap and the outside of the pipe with a PVC primer earlier than making use of solvent cement. Contaminants weaken the bond and enhance the danger of leaks.
Tip 3: Use Suitable Solvent Cement: Make the most of solely PVC cement that’s particularly formulated for the kind and schedule of PVC pipe getting used. Incompatible cements compromise the chemical bond and scale back long-term reliability.
Tip 4: Apply Solvent Cement Evenly: Guarantee a uniform coating of solvent cement on each surfaces, avoiding extreme accumulation or dry spots. Uneven cement distribution creates weak factors within the joint.
Tip 5: Enable Satisfactory Curing Time: Adhere strictly to the producer’s really useful curing time for the solvent cement earlier than subjecting the joint to stress. Untimely pressurization can disrupt the bonding course of and trigger leaks.
Tip 6: Contemplate Environmental Circumstances: Be conscious of temperature and humidity throughout set up, as these components can have an effect on the curing fee of the solvent cement. Regulate set up procedures accordingly.
Tip 7: Doc Set up Particulars: Preserve a report of the cap dimension, solvent cement used, set up date, and any related observations. This documentation facilitates future upkeep and troubleshooting.
